Gleaming beaches, glamorous guest rooms, and gourmet cuisine are just some of the features of the best luxury all-inclusive Caribbean resorts. Knowing your stay includes food, beverages, and many activities means you can relax and enjoy your vacation without worrying about hidden extras. The Caribbean offers all-inclusive luxury hotels to suit every type of traveler, whether you want to unplug from the workaday world or sign up for a busy schedule of tropical adventures. You can escape to a private island, hide away at an adults-only haven, or frolic with the family at an activity-packed resort. Return guests are a testament to the quality of a resort, and all these contenders boast hordes of loyal followers. Positive first impressions are hard to come by in the midst of Lima's coastal fog , honking buses and a general air of big city chaos. If you reserve judgment for a day or two, however, you might find yourself falling for the so-called "City of Kings," with its incredibly history and culture and world-class gastronomic traditions. A colonial fountain serves as the square's centerpiece, while some of Lima's most important buildings surround the historic plaza. Arm yourself with a camera and take a trip to the Palacio de Gobierno, official home to Peru's President, on the northern side of the square where, at noon, you can watch the changing of the palace guard. Further photo opportunities include the Archbishop's Palace and the Municipal Palace Lima's City Hall , both of which are adorned with ornately carved, and magnificently preserved, wooden balconies.
